小编Mar*_*cus的帖子

Java Web Start:自Java 8 Update 111以来无法通过代理进行隧道传输

自Java 8 Update 111以来,我们的一些客户无法再运行我们的Java Web Start客户端了.他们得到:

java.io.IOException:无法通过代理进行隧道传输.代理返回"需要HTTP/1.1 407代理身份验证

看起来它与此更改有关:

现在,默认情况下,在为HTTPS设置隧道时需要基本身份验证的代理将不再成功.如果需要,可以通过从jdk.http.auth.tunneling.disabledSchemes网络属性中删除Basic,或者通过在命令行上将同名的系统属性设置为""(空)来重新激活此身份验证方案.

如果客户不愿意改变他们的代理身份验证方法,有什么办法吗?

注意:添加<property name="jdk.http.auth.tunneling.disabledSchemes" value=""/><resources>JNLP无效.这是因为这种方式只支持少数属性(本页底部附近有一个列表)."jdk.http.auth.tunneling.disabledSchemes"不在其中.

java https proxy tunneling java-web-start

16
推荐指数
3
解决办法
2万
查看次数

类似 GROUP BY 和 Logs Explorer 的东西

我正在尝试找出有关我的网站上可疑流量的详细信息,该网站在 Google Cloud(更具体地说,带有 Java 的 Google App Engine)上运行。一种想法是分析哪些 IP 地址经常发送请求。在 SQL 中我会做类似的事情

\n
SELECT \n  protoPayload.ip,\n  COUNT(protoPayload.ip) AS `ip_occurrence` \nFROM \n  foo /* TODO replace foo with correct table name */ \nWHERE \n  protoPayload.ip NOT LIKE \'66.249.77.%\' /* ignore Google bots */\nGROUP BY \n  protoPayload.ip\nORDER BY \n  `ip_occurrence` DESC\nLIMIT 100\n
Run Code Online (Sandbox Code Playgroud)\n

但我不知道如何使用日志资源管理器执行此操作。\xe2\x80\x9c Log Analytics \xe2\x80\x9d 似乎允许此类 SQL,但要求仅在非生产项目上使用它。

\n

我也尝试从 Logs Explorer 下载日志,但日志数量限制为 10,000 条,根本不够。

\n

有什么简单的办法吗?

\n

从更大的角度来看,我正在尝试重新开放我的 AdSense 帐户。到目前为止我失败了。也许我提供的证据,我的谷歌分析数据,不够有力。表单上的字段描述提到了 IP 地址。但在 Google Analytics 中我没有看到任何 IP 地址...

\n

google-cloud-logging

7
推荐指数
1
解决办法
6972
查看次数

像"mvn undeploy"这样的东西可以从Nexus中删除文物?

mvn deploy对一个包含50多个模块的项目(到本地Nexus)之后,我意识到部署的工件具有所有错误的文件名(后缀zip而不是war等).

是否有类似的东西想mvn undeploy从Nexus中删除这些?

nexus maven

6
推荐指数
1
解决办法
4649
查看次数

以编程方式获取谷歌搜索结果计数的最简单(合法)方式?

我想使用Java代码获取某些Google搜索引擎查询(在整个网络上)的估算结果计数.

我每天只需要进行非常少量的查询,因此最初Google Web Search API虽然已被弃用,但看起来还不错(例如,您如何搜索Google Programmatically Java API).但事实证明,此API返回的数字与www.google.com返回的数字非常不同(请参阅http://code.google.com/p/google-ajax-apis/issues/detail?id = 32).所以这些数字对我来说都没用.

我也尝试了谷歌自定义搜索引擎,它表现出同样的问题.

您认为我的任务最简单的解决方案是什么?

java google-search

5
推荐指数
1
解决办法
8984
查看次数

Confluence:复制到剪贴板按钮

我正在使用 Confluence 5.10.8。在某些页面上,我有几个文本片段可供读者复制到剪贴板。对于每个文本片段,我希望能够添加一个不可编辑的文本字段和一个按钮,以便在单击它时将文本复制到剪贴板,可能如下所示:

在此输入图像描述

我还需要一些视觉反馈来表明文本已被复制。

我认为用户宏是执行此操作的正确选择,对吧?类似的东西(尚未复制):

## @param Text:title=Text|type=string|required=true|desc=The text to be displayed and copied 
<!-- font-awesome contains the clipboard icon -->
<link rel="stylesheet" href="https://cdnjs.cloudflare.com/ajax/libs/font-awesome/4.7.0/css/font-awesome.min.css"> 
<span style="white-space: nowrap">
    <input type="text" value="$paramText" size="$paramText.length()" readonly>
    <button class="fa fa-clipboard" title="click to copy">
</span>
Run Code Online (Sandbox Code Playgroud)

confluence

5
推荐指数
1
解决办法
9729
查看次数

溢出时赛普拉斯滚动问题:自动

我正在测试一个包含 div 的网络应用程序

\n
<div style="overflow: auto; max-height: 429px;" \xe2\x80\xa6\n
Run Code Online (Sandbox Code Playgroud)\n

其中包含一张大桌子。我看到桌子周围有滚动条。现在我希望 Cypress 单击表中的一个元素。如果该元素隐藏在某个地方,那就没问题。Cypress 会自动滚动到那里。但如果该元素隐藏在右侧的某个位置,Cypress 将不会滚动到正确的位置,而是会抱怨:

\n
\n

CypressError:10050ms后超时重试:cy.click()失败,因为该元素的中心从视图中隐藏:`<input type =“radio”\ xe2 \ x80 \ xa6

\n
\n

这是为什么?我能做些什么?

\n

我正在使用最新的赛普拉斯(13.6.2)。

\n

编辑:事实证明存在两个不同的问题:

\n
    \n
  1. 对于某些元素,Cypress 确实会自动滚动,但没有滚动到正确的位置。
  2. \n
  3. 对于极少数元素,Cypress 根本不会自动滚动。
  4. \n
\n

第一个问题发生在“overflow: auto”内的宽表中。当我将显示行为从默认的“顶部”切换到“中心”后,第二个问题发生在没有任何溢出上下文的情况下。

\n

cypress

0
推荐指数
2
解决办法
139
查看次数